The ingredients needed to make Spanish Omelet:
  1. Get 1 sweet onion
  2. Prepare 1-3 potatoes
  3. Take 6 eggs
  4. Take 1/2 liter olive oil
  5. Get Pinch Sea Salt
Steps to make Spanish Omelet:
  1. Pour 1/2 liter olive oil in a pan, high heat
  2. Thinly slice the onion and put into the pan
  3. Thinly slice the potatoes and place in pan
  4. Leave the onion and potatoes in the pan for 10-15 minutes or until they caramelize
  5. Once they caramelize, remove the potatoes and onion and place then in a large mixing bowel
  6. Add 6 eggs and pinch of sea salt into the mixing bowel and gently mix
  7. Place aluminum foil and cover for 15 minutes
  8. Place 1 tbsp of olive oil (the same one used earlier) in a pan and put on high heat
  9. Place the mixed ingredients and place in the pan. 1-2 mins on high then lower on medium heat for 2-3 mins.
  10. Take a plate and flip the omelet to the other side
  11. Cook the other side: 1-2 mins on high, 2-3 minutes on medium heat
  12. Once it is cooked, remove from heat and place on a plate
